2006-05073 In the Matter of Sandy Annabi, etc. et al., respondents, v City Council of City of Yonkers, etc., et al., appellants. (Action No. 1) (Index No. 05-20829) In the Matter of County of Westhchester, respondent, v City of Yonkers, etc., et al., appellants. (Action No. 2) (Index No. 05-21293)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Motion by FC Yonkers Associates, LLC, and FC Yonkers Commercial, LLC, for leave to intervene on an appeal from an order and judgment (one paper) of the Supreme Court, Westchester County, dated May 2, 2006, or, in the alternative, for leave to serve and file an amicus curiae brief.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in relation thereto, it is
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is for leave to intervene is denied; and it is further,
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is for leave to serve and file an amicus curiae brief is denied with leave to renew when the appeal is perfected.
KRAUSMAN, J.P., GOLDSTEIN, SPOLZINO and SKELOS, JJ., concur.
